Ordinals
beta
Sat 1258453189113853
decimal
293381.689113853
degree
0°83381′1061″689113853‴
percentile
59.9263424046739%
name
exyvryqpjxk
cycle
0
epoch
1
period
145
block
293381
offset
689113853
timestamp
2014-03-31 10:59:58 UTC
rarity
common
prev
next